Market Analysis and Insights: Global Molecular Cytogenetics Market
The global Molecular Cytogenetics market is projected to grow from US$ 1764.7 million in 2024 to US$ 2816 million by 2030, at a Compound Annual Growth Rate (CAGR) of 8.1% during the forecast period.
Geographically, North America dominates the global molecular cytogenetics market.
